#dba3f5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dba3f5 is composed of 85.9% red, 63.9% green and 96.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.6% cyan, 33.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 281 degrees, a saturation of 80.4% and a lightness of 80%. #dba3f5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b747eb. Closest websafe color is: #cc99ff.

#dba3f5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dba3f5 has RGB values of R:219, G:163, B:245 and CMYK values of C:0.11, M:0.33,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 14394357.

Shades and Tints of #dba3f5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a020e is the darkest color, while #fefbff is the lightest one.

Tones of #dba3f5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#cdcace is the less saturated color, while #de9bfd is the most saturated one.
